OK, I've rip and created an xvid avi file and I have the audio. I muxed with Virtualdub Mod, but the output file is out of sync. Each time that I try, I get a muxed file in which the audio leads video. Can anyone help me with this?
-
Originally Posted by james636
- Load VOB file into VirtualdubMOD
- Check "File Information" to get audio skew info (each VOB I had was different)
- Select clip to pull out (optional? - this was my main task)
- Go to "Streams" menu, "Stream List"; right-click on the audio stream, select "Interleaving"
- In "Audio skew correction" box put in value from "File Info" including negative sign if present
- Save as AVI
The resulting AVI should be sync'd properly.

Well part of your method worked for me; I did manage to use some of your tips in order to sync my movie. The part that didn't work, for me anyway, was loading the vob in VDMOD and getting the skew info on the audio. Well all that did was tell me what I'd known all along; That my audio had no delay (0ms delay)
All I did was tinker with the "Delay Audio Track by" option until my clip was in sync. BTW, my audio was leading my video by 2000ms.
